Antique Dealers and Resellers

Antique dealers and resellers are another potential market for selling your collectibles locally. These professionals specialize in identifying valuable items and have extensive knowledge about specific niches within the collecting world. They often have established connections with other collectors or buyers who trust their expertise.

When selling to antique dealers or resellers near you, it is essential to do thorough research on the value of your collectible beforehand. This will help ensure that you receive a fair price for your item while also allowing the dealer or reseller to make a profit when they sell it on to their network.

Interior Designers and Decorators

Collectibles can also serve as decorative pieces in homes or offices. Interior designers and decorators often seek out distinctive items to add character and charm to their clients’ spaces. By targeting this market segment, you can tap into a group of individuals who appreciate the aesthetic appeal of collectibles.

To attract interior designers and decorators near you, consider showcasing your collectibles in local art galleries or design showrooms. Collaborating with these professionals can not only result in sales but also open doors to other opportunities within the interior design industry.
